Bristol Rovers see off Bromley to reach FA Cup second round

Bristol Rovers booked their spot in the second round of the FA Cup with a smash-and-grab victory at Bromley.

The game took a while to break into life and it was not until the 25th minute that Fabrizio Cavegn had the first genuine chance on goal, shooting into the side-netting when well set.

At the other end Luke Southwood did well to deny Jude Arthurs.

Bromley sprung into life on the hour mark and Southwood produced three great saves to deny Michael Cheek twice and Mitchell Pinnock. With Bromley continuing to press, Jemiah Umolu headed on to the roof of the net with Southwood beaten.

It was Rovers who took the lead however with 14 minutes remaining, Cavegn heading in after great work from Luke Thomas.

Cavegn turned provider four minutes later as he broke away and squared for Joel Cotterill to have the simple task of tapping home.

Bromley set up a grandstand finish with Umolu’s near-post header seven minutes from time and Omar Sowunmi appeared to have equalised in the second minute of stoppage time but the goal was chalked out, much to the outrage of the Bromley bench.
